DeSantis Takes ⁣Stand Against ⁢Chinese Control ⁢of USA on 2 Huge Issues Not ⁤on Voters’ Radar

During Wednesday⁢ night’s GOP debate, amidst the ‍usual ⁢political banter, there were a few ⁢moments of substance that went unnoticed by most American ⁣voters. One of these moments came from Florida Governor ⁣Ron DeSantis, who promised to prevent Chinese‌ interests from buying American ⁤farmland and spreading Beijing’s propaganda ⁣through Confucius Institutes if he were to become president.

DeSantis expressed confidence in his ability to achieve this goal, citing his ‌success in ‍banning ‌the Chinese Communist Party (CCP) from buying land in Florida. He emphasized the need for a new‌ approach to China, ⁣advocating ‌for economic independence and countering their cultural ‌power in the United States.

The ‍issue of China’s influence ⁢may seem unfamiliar to many Americans, but it is a​ significant threat to our food security and national security. China currently owns a ⁢substantial amount⁤ of U.S. farmland,⁤ and Confucius​ Institutes have been used ​as propaganda tools on college campuses.
